And indeed, warnings came to the people of Fir'aun (Pharaoh) [through Musa (Moses) and Harun (Aaron)]. 41 They denied all Our signs, We therefore seized them the seizure of the Most Honourable, the All Powerful. 42 Are your disbelievers better than those, or have ye some immunity in the scriptures? 43 Or do they say, "We are a united group, and we are bound to prevail?" 44 (Let them know that) this united group will soon run away in defeat. 45 Nay, but the Hour is their tryst, and the Hour is very calamitous and bitter. 46 Indeed, the criminals are in error and madness. 47 On the Day when they shall be dragged into the fire on their faces, [they will be told:] "Taste now the touch of hell-fire!" 48 We have created everything in a determined measure. 49 And Our Order is but one word like the flashing of an eye. 50 And assuredly We have destroyed your likes; so is there any one who shall be admonished? 51 All things they do are (recorded) in the books; 52 every action, small or great, is noted down. 53 Surely those who guard (against evil) shall be in gardens and rivers, 54 At the still centre in the proximity of the King all-powerful. 55
Allah Almighty has spoken the truth.
End of Surah: The Moon (Al-Qamar). Sent down in Mecca after The Comet (Al-Taareq) before S (Saad)
